Cows (and other mammals) usually only produce milk if they have the proper hormone levels that coincide with pregnancy (or are given specific hormones to mock a pregnancy so they can produce milk) Just having plastic surgery will not increase your chances of producing milk. In fact, it may harm you- if you do get pregnant, mammary glands will tend to swell at a certain point, which can be painful if you have an implant, and the impact may impede milk flow, if a shoddy surgery has been done.
Cows do not get plastic surgery. People get it mainly to enhance their own sex appeal. Cows don't need this, plus it can run the risk of infection. Plus, most cows end up going to slaughter eventually. No point in doing a big surgery like that only to kill them a few years later. |
